HB5553

Relating to participation in federal prescription drug pricing programs.

West Virginia HB5553 permits the Public Employees Insurance Agency and the Department of Human Services to participate in federal prescription drug pricing programs. Participation may include direct purchasing agreements, federally negotiated pricing arrangements, and federal benchmarks or ceiling prices. Participation is voluntary and only if it benefits the state financially and maintains access to necessary drugs. The bill also mandates annual reporting on participation, cost savings, and any access or administrative issues.
